كيف تبني تطبيق آيفون مستقر وسريع مع تجربة استخدام ممتازة وخطة إطلاق ذكية في الأردن والسعودية ودول الخليج

دليل مراحل تصميم وتطوير تطبيقات iOS الاحترافية: من الفكرة حتى النشر والتوسع يساعدك تفهم الطريق الصحيح لبناء تطبيق آيفون تجاري ناجح. كثير أفكار ممتازة تفشل لأن التنفيذ يبدأ من البرمجة قبل ما تثبت الفكرة، أو لأن تجربة الاستخدام معقدة، أو لأن الاختبار ضعيف قبل النشر. في هذا الدليل سنرتّب المراحل بطريقة عملية تناسب مشاريع الأردن والسعودية ودول الخليج، مع تركيز على ما يصنع الثقة: الجودة، الأمان، والقدرة على التوسع.

1) مرحلة الاستكشاف: الفكرة، السوق، والميزانية

هذه المرحلة هي “حماية المشروع” من القرارات العشوائية.

  • تحديد المشكلة التي يحلها التطبيق بجملة واحدة واضحة.

  • تحديد الجمهور: من هم؟ ولماذا سيستخدمون التطبيق؟

  • تحليل المنافسين: ما الذي ينجح لديهم؟ وما الذي يشتكي منه المستخدمون؟

  • تحديد نطاق الإصدار الأول: أساسي/مؤجل حتى لا تتضخم التكلفة.

  • وضع ميزانية واقعية: الميزانية تتغير حسب عدد الشاشات والميزات والتكاملات.

2) قبل التصميم: تحديد مسار المستخدم الأساسي

قبل رسم أي واجهة، حدّد المسار الذي تريد أن يكمله المستخدم.

  • تسجيل/دخول

  • إجراء أساسي (طلب/حجز/شراء/اشتراك)

  • تأكيد وإشعار
    إذا وضّحت هذا المسار، يصبح التصميم والتنفيذ أسرع وأكثر دقة.

3) تجربة المستخدم (UX): لماذا يتسرب المستخدمون؟

هدف تجربة المستخدم هو جعل التطبيق “مريحاً” وسهل الاستخدام.

  • تقليل عدد الخطوات للوصول للهدف.

  • تقليل الحقول في النماذج.

  • تصميم حالات واقعية: ضعف شبكة، خطأ إدخال، تحميل، فشل عملية.

  • جعل الإجراء الرئيسي واضحاً في كل شاشة مهمة.

4) واجهة المستخدم (UI): هوية واضحة وثقة أسرع

واجهة iOS الناجحة تجمع بين البساطة والوضوح.

  • ألوان متناسقة وخطوط مقروءة.

  • أزرار واضحة ومسافات مريحة للموبايل.

  • شاشات منظمة بدون ازدحام معلومات.

  • تصميم متسق عبر كل الصفحات.

5) اختيار التقنية: تطبيق iOS فقط أم نظامين؟

الاختيار يعتمد على خطة مشروعك:

  • إذا جمهورك الأساسي على iPhone فقط: قد تبدأ بتطبيق iOS.

  • إذا جمهورك موزع بين iPhone وAndroid: غالباً تحتاج خطة تشمل النظامين من البداية أو بشكل مرحلي.

المهم هنا ليس الاسم، بل القرار التشغيلي: هل تريد إطلاقاً سريعاً ثم توسع؟ أم تريد أعلى أداء خاص بنظام واحد من البداية؟

6) البرمجة وبناء التطبيق

هذه المرحلة تتحول فيها الشاشات لمسارات تعمل فعلياً.

  • بناء الواجهات وربطها بالبيانات.

  • بناء المنطق الأساسي: طلب/حجز/دفع/تتبع… حسب المشروع.

  • ربط الإشعارات إن كانت جزءاً من تجربة المستخدم.

  • تجهيز إدارة الأخطاء برسائل واضحة للمستخدم.

7) البنية الخلفية ولوحة الإدارة: أساس التشغيل

كثير تطبيقات تفشل لأن التشغيل يصبح يدوياً.

  • قاعدة بيانات منظمة.

  • صلاحيات حسب الدور عند وجود إدارة أو فريق تشغيل.

  • لوحة إدارة لتحديث المحتوى وإدارة الطلبات والعملاء.

  • تقارير أساسية تساعدك تفهم الاستخدام وتشغيل التطبيق.

8) الاختبار قبل النشر: أهم مرحلة لحماية السمعة

تطبيق آيفون قد يُرفض أو يتعرض لتقييمات سلبية إذا خرج مع أخطاء.

  • اختبار المسار الأساسي من البداية للنهاية.

  • اختبار الأداء على أجهزة مختلفة.

  • اختبار حالات ضعف الشبكة.

  • اختبار الإشعارات وتشغيل التطبيق في الخلفية.

  • التأكد من وضوح رسائل الخطأ والنجاح.

9) الأمان والخصوصية: خصوصاً للتطبيقات التجارية

تطبيقات iOS معروفة ببيئة قوية، لكن التطبيق نفسه يحتاج ضبط صحيح.

  • اتصال آمن.

  • حماية بيانات الدخول.

  • صلاحيات واضحة للوصول للبيانات.

  • نسخ احتياطي وخطة استعادة إذا كان لديك نظام مرتبط بالتطبيق.

  • مراجعة أي صلاحيات يطلبها التطبيق حتى لا تكون غير مبررة.

10) النشر على متجر التطبيقات

بعد اجتياز الاختبار، تأتي مرحلة النشر:

  • تجهيز معلومات التطبيق وصوره ووصفه بشكل واضح.

  • التأكد من أن التطبيق يقدم تجربة مستقرة على iOS.

  • إعداد خطة إصدار: إصدار أول ثم تحديثات قصيرة مبنية على بيانات الاستخدام.

11) بعد النشر: النمو والتحسين

الإطلاق ليس النهاية، بل بداية القياس والتحسين.

  • قياس أين يتسرب المستخدمون.

  • تحسين المسارات التي تؤثر على التحويل.

  • إضافة ميزات تدريجية حسب البيانات، لا حسب التخمين.

  • تحسين الأداء والاستقرار قبل إضافة تعقيدات جديدة.

12) أخطاء شائعة يجب تجنبها

  • بناء تطبيق ضخم من البداية بدون إصدار أول واضح.

  • تصميم جميل لكن مسار معقد.

  • تجاهل لوحة الإدارة والتقارير.

  • اختبار ضعيف قبل النشر.

  • عدم وجود خطة صيانة وتحديثات.

كيف تطبق الخطوات عملياً؟

  • اكتب هدف التطبيق بجملة واحدة واضحة.

  • صمّم مسار المستخدم الأساسي (5–7 شاشات) للإصدار الأول.

  • جهّز لوحة إدارة مبكراً إذا كان التطبيق مرتبطاً بالطلبات أو التشغيل.

  • اختبر ثم انشر ثم حسّن بناءً على بيانات حقيقية.

لماذا تصميم مسار المستخدم هو العامل الأكبر في سرعة واستقرار تطبيق iOS؟

استقرار وسرعة تطبيق الآيفون لا يعتمدان على البرمجة فقط، بل على وضوح مسار المستخدم قبل التنفيذ. عندما يكون المسار الأساسي محدداً بوضوح—مثل تسجيل الدخول ثم تنفيذ إجراء رئيسي ثم تأكيد النتيجة—يمكن بناء التطبيق بطريقة منظمة تقلل التعقيد والأخطاء. هذا يقلل عدد الحالات غير المتوقعة، ويساعد على تحسين الأداء لأن كل شاشة وكل طلب بيانات يكون له هدف واضح. التطبيقات التي تبدأ بتجربة استخدام بسيطة ومدروسة تكون أسهل في الاختبار، وأسرع في التشغيل، وأكثر قدرة على تقديم تجربة سلسة للمستخدمين من أول إصدار.

كيف تضمن إطلاق تطبيق iOS بجودة عالية مع قابلية للتوسع بعد النشر؟

إطلاق تطبيق ناجح لا ينتهي عند النشر في App Store، بل يعتمد على وجود بنية تشغيل تدعم النمو المستمر. يشمل ذلك قاعدة بيانات منظمة، ولوحة إدارة للتحكم بالمحتوى والمستخدمين، ونظام تقارير يساعد على فهم سلوك المستخدمين وتحسين التطبيق بناءً على بيانات حقيقية. كما أن الاختبار الشامل قبل النشر، ومراقبة الأداء بعد الإطلاق، يسمحان باكتشاف المشاكل مبكراً وتحسين الاستقرار تدريجياً. هذا النهج يجعل التطبيق ليس مجرد إصدار أول، بل منصة قابلة للتوسع والتطوير المستمر مع نمو عدد المستخدمين وتوسع نطاق الخدمة.

الأسئلة الشائعة

1) ما أول خطوة قبل برمجة تطبيق iOS لضمان نجاحه؟
حدد المشكلة بجملة واحدة، وارسم مسار المستخدم الأساسي (تسجيل → إجراء → تأكيد) قبل أي واجهات.
هذا يقلل التشتت ويجعل التصميم والتنفيذ أسرع ويمنع تضخم المتطلبات من البداية.

2) هل أبدأ بتطبيق iOS فقط أم لازم iOS وAndroid من البداية؟
إذا جمهورك فعلاً أغلبه آيفون وتريد إطلاقاً سريعاً، ممكن تبدأ iOS ثم تتوسع.
أما إذا جمهورك موزع في الأردن والسعودية ودول الخليج، غالباً خطة للنظامين من البداية (أو مرحلياً) تكون أذكى.

3) ما الذي يجعل تطبيق الآيفون “سريعاً ومستقراً” فعلياً؟
تقليل الشاشات الثقيلة، تحسين تحميل البيانات والصور، وإدارة حالات الشبكة الضعيفة بشكل صحيح.
والأهم: اختبار المسار الأساسي على أجهزة مختلفة ومراقبة الأعطال من أول إصدار.

4) هل لوحة الإدارة والتقارير ضرورية لتطبيق iOS تجاري؟
نعم إذا عندك تشغيل يومي (طلبات/حجوزات/محتوى/شكاوى).
بدون لوحة إدارة وصلاحيات وتقارير، التشغيل يتحول لرسائل وملفات ويزيد الأخطاء بعد الإطلاق.

5) ما أكثر أسباب رفض التطبيقات في App Store وكيف أتجنبها؟
طلب صلاحيات غير مبررة، نقص روابط الخصوصية/الشروط عند الحاجة، أو تجربة غير مستقرة أثناء المراجعة.
تأكد من وضوح سبب أي صلاحية، وجهّز بيانات المتجر والروابط، واختبر كل السيناريوهات قبل الإرسال.

6) ما أفضل خطة إطلاق لتقليل المخاطر بعد النشر؟
ابدأ بإطلاق تدريجي أو نسخة أولى مركزة، وراقب أول أسبوعين: الإكمال، التسرب، والأعطال.
ثم حسّن المسار الأساسي أولاً قبل إضافة ميزات جديدة، وخلي التحديثات قصيرة ومبنية على بيانات.

هل تبحث عن شريك تقني موثوق؟ تطوير تطبيقات الجوال.